What is Colorectal Cancer?
Colorectal cancer originates in the colon or rectum, parts of the large intestine. It usually develops from adenomatous polyps, which are benign growths on the inner lining of the colon or rectum. Over time, some polyps can become cancerous, forming malignant tumors. This cancer is common worldwide, affecting both men and women. Risk factors include age (most cases occur in people over 50), family history, genetic conditions like Lynch syndrome, and lifestyle factors such as a diet high in processed foods, low fiber intake, physical inactivity, smoking, and excessive alcohol consumption. Symptoms may include changes in bowel habits, blood in the stool, abdominal discomfort, unexplained weight loss, and fatigue. Early detection through screenings like colonoscopies is vital, as it allows for the removal of precancerous polyps and early-stage cancers, improving treatment outcomes. Treatment options include surgery, chemotherapy, radiation therapy, and targeted therapies, depending on the cancer's stage and location. Awareness and proactive health measures are essential for reducing risk and improving survival rates.

Types of Colorectal Cancer

Colorectal cancer can be categorized into several types based on the cells from which it originates. The main types include:

  1. Adenocarcinoma: The most common type, accounting for about 95% of cases. It starts in the glandular cells of the colon or rectum, which produce mucus. Subtypes include mucinous and signet-ring cell adenocarcinomas.

  2. Carcinoid Tumors: Rare tumors that arise from neuroendocrine cells in the gastrointestinal tract. They can produce hormones, causing symptoms like flushing or diarrhea.

  3. Gastrointestinal Stromal Tumors (GISTs): Rare tumors that develop from connective tissues in the gastrointestinal tract, most commonly in the stomach or small intestine but can occur in the colon or rectum.

  4. Lymphomas: These cancers, which primarily affect the lymphatic system, can also occur in the colon or rectum.

  5. Squamous Cell Carcinoma: Extremely rare in the colon and rectum, it usually occurs in the anal region.

  6. Other Rare Types: Includes small cell carcinoma and sarcomas, which arise from connective tissues.

Understanding the specific type of colorectal cancer is crucial for determining the appropriate treatment and prognosis. Early detection and accurate diagnosis significantly improve treatment outcomes.

Subtypes of Colorectal Cancer

Colorectal cancer, primarily adenocarcinoma, has several subtypes with varying characteristics:

  1. Mucinous Adenocarcinoma: Produces a significant amount of mucus and accounts for 10-15% of cases. It is often more aggressive.

  2. Signet-Ring Cell Adenocarcinoma: Characterized by signet-ring cells, this rare subtype is aggressive and often diagnosed at an advanced stage.

  3. Poorly Differentiated Adenocarcinoma: Cancer cells appear more abnormal and less like normal cells, often correlating with aggressive behavior.

  4. Serrated Adenocarcinoma: Arises from serrated polyps and is associated with a distinct tumor development pathway.

  5. Carcinoid Tumors: Rare neuroendocrine tumors that may produce hormones, leading to specific symptoms.

Each subtype presents unique challenges in diagnosis and treatment, emphasizing the importance of personalized medical approaches.

Symptoms and Causes

Symptoms of Colorectal Cancer
Symptoms can vary and may include:

  • Changes in bowel habits (diarrhea, constipation, or stool consistency).

  • Blood in the stool (bright red or dark).

  • Abdominal discomfort (pain, cramps, or bloating).

  • Unexplained weight loss.

  • Fatigue.

  • Narrow stools.

  • Feeling that the bowel isn’t emptying completely.

If symptoms persist, consult a healthcare provider for screening and diagnosis. Early intervention improves treatment outcomes.

Causes of Colorectal Cancer
Colorectal cancer arises from a combination of genetic, environmental, and lifestyle factors:

  • Genetic Factors: Inherited mutations like Lynch syndrome or familial adenomatous polyposis (FAP) increase risk.

  • Age: Risk increases with age, particularly after 50.

  • Diet: High red and processed meat intake and low fiber consumption increase risk.

  • Physical Inactivity: Sedentary lifestyles are linked to higher risk.

  • Obesity: Excess body weight contributes to inflammation and insulin resistance, promoting cancer development.

  • Smoking and Alcohol: Both increase the risk of colorectal cancer.

Understanding these factors aids in prevention and early detection strategies.

Complications of Colorectal Cancer

Colorectal cancer can lead to serious complications, including:

  • Metastasis: Spread to other organs like the liver or lungs.

  • Bowel Obstruction: Tumors can block the colon or rectum, causing severe pain and constipation.

  • Perforation: Advanced cancer can weaken the intestinal wall, leading to rupture and peritonitis.

  • Anemia: Chronic blood loss from the tumor can cause fatigue and weakness.

  • Fistulas: Abnormal connections between the colon and other organs, leading to infections.

  • Psychosocial Impact: Emotional distress, depression, and anxiety.

Timely diagnosis and treatment are crucial in managing these complications.

Diagnosis and Tests

Diagnosing colorectal cancer involves:

  • Medical History and Symptoms Review: Assessing symptoms like changes in bowel habits or blood in the stool.

  • Physical Examination: Including a digital rectal exam (DRE).

  • Screening Tests: Colonoscopy (gold standard), flexible sigmoidoscopy, and fecal tests (FOBT or FIT).

  • Imaging Tests: CT scans, MRIs, or ultrasounds to determine the extent of the disease.

  • Biopsy: Tissue samples are examined microscopically for cancer cells.

Early diagnosis is crucial for effective treatment.

Stages of Colorectal Cancer

Colorectal cancer is staged using the AJCC system:

  • Stage 0: Cancer is localized to the inner lining (carcinoma in situ).

  • Stage I: Cancer has grown into the outer layer but not spread to lymph nodes.

  • Stage II: Cancer has penetrated deeper into the colon or rectum wall but not reached lymph nodes.

  • Stage III: Cancer has spread to nearby lymph nodes.

  • Stage IV: Cancer has metastasized to distant organs.

Understanding the stage is crucial for treatment planning and predicting outcomes.

Management and Treatment

Treatment depends on the cancer's stage, location, and the patient’s health. Options include:

  • Surgery: Polypectomy, partial colectomy, or colostomy/ileostomy.

  • Chemotherapy: Used before or after surgery to shrink tumors or eliminate remaining cancer cells.

  • Radiation Therapy: Often used for rectal cancer to reduce tumor size.

  • Targeted Therapy: Drugs that target specific cancer cell mechanisms.

  • Immunotherapy: Helps the immune system attack cancer cells.

Treatment is personalized, and regular follow-ups are essential for monitoring effectiveness.

Treatment Side Effects

Side effects vary by treatment type:

  • Surgery: Pain, swelling, fatigue, and changes in bowel habits.

  • Chemotherapy: Nausea, vomiting, fatigue, hair loss, and increased infection risk.

  • Radiation Therapy: Skin irritation, fatigue, and gastrointestinal issues.

  • Targeted Therapy: Skin rashes, fatigue, and liver function changes.

  • Immunotherapy: Immune-related side effects like inflammation in organs.

Managing side effects is crucial for maintaining quality of life during treatment.

Prevention

Colorectal cancer can be prevented through:

  • Regular Screening: Colonoscopies can detect and remove precancerous polyps.

  • Healthy Diet: High in fruits, vegetables, and whole grains; low in red and processed meats.

  • Physical Activity: At least 150 minutes of moderate exercise weekly.

  • Weight Management: Maintaining a healthy weight reduces risk.

  • Avoiding Tobacco and Limiting Alcohol: Both are linked to increased risk.

These measures can significantly reduce the risk of colorectal cancer.

Outlook / Prognosis

Survival Rates
Survival rates depend on the cancer's stage at diagnosis:

  • Stage 0: Nearly 100% 5-year survival rate.

  • Stage I: Approximately 90% or higher.

  • Stage II: 70-85%.

  • Stage III: 50-70%.

  • Stage IV: 10-15%.

Advancements in treatment, including targeted therapies and immunotherapy, are improving outcomes.

Additional Common Questions

How long can you have Colorectal Cancer without knowing?
Colorectal cancer can develop slowly over years without noticeable symptoms, especially in its early stages. Regular screenings are crucial for early detection.

How fast does Colorectal Cancer spread?
The spread of colorectal cancer varies. It typically grows slowly, but factors like genetics, tumor type, and overall health can influence its progression. Early detection through screenings is key to improving outcomes.
